This movie is not, technically, a very good movie. The art's pretty decent -- one can tell they had a higher budget for this movie than for the TV series -- the soundtrack's fine but not outstanding, the characterization is about what you'd expect for a Prince of Tennis movie (i.e. minimal), and the plot is frankly ridiculous.

In fact, this movie is ridiculous and over-the-top in a number of ways, and that's exactly what's so great about it. It takes the "junior high school tennis is serious and manly!" theme of the TV series and turns it up to eleven in ways that deny logic, ...

I'm a big fan of the series, but a bit disappointed with this movie...
I think the people who made this movie is a bit too hurried to decide on the characters.
They made this filler character, Ryoga Echizen, Ryoma's older adopted brother. In the movie he entered ryoma's house when he was a kid. Then Ryoga went missing through the entire series... come back for a brief moment on the movie, then went missing again...

It's just too weird...
